Isu Tree DISTYLIUM racemosum
Prices start at : 8.95 USD / 1 packet

* Distylium racemosum is an evergreen Shrub growing to 2 m (6ft) by 3 m (9ft) at a slow rate. * The ashes of the wood are used in glazing porcelain. * A very valuable wood, it is used for small articles, musical instruments etc.

Fortune\'s Keteleeria Keteleeria fortunei
Price : CALL

The species is named after Scottish botanist Robert Fortune, who discovered the tree in 1844. The tree grows in hills, mountains, and broadleaf forests at elevations of 200–1400 m.

Western Red Cedar, Western Redcedar Thuja plicata
Prices start at : 4.95 USD / 1 packet

* The inner bark has been used for making baskets. * This species can be grown as a hedge or as part of a shelterbelt. * It is long-lived; some individuals can live well over a thousand years, with the oldest verified being 1,460 years.

Japanese Hornbeam Carpinus japonica
Prices start at : 5.95 USD / 1 packet

The leaves are dark, glossy and slender, with 20-24 pairs of parallel sunken veins; every third tooth is whisker-tipped. It grows to 12-15m tall with leaves that are longer and darker than the European Hornbeam (Carpinus betulus).

European Hornbeam, Hornbeam Carpinus betulus     - Carpinus caucasica
Prices start at : 3.95 USD / 1 packet

* Plants can be grown as a medium to tall hedge, they retain their dead leaves throughout the winter if clipped at least once a year in late summer. * Carpinus betulus is a shade-loving tree, which prefers moderate soil fertility and moisture.
